Historical Context: From Land-Based Casinos to Digital Platforms

Historically, Canadian gambling was predominantly localized—governed by provincial authorities overseeing brick-and-mortar establishments. However, the advent of the internet in the late 20th century precipitated a surge of online casino platforms, many operating without licensure or regulation. This created a complex environment where consumers were exposed to both legitimate and dubious operators.

By 2015, progressive provinces like Ontario and Quebec began formalising regulations to legalise and supervise online gambling, integrating technological compliance standards and consumer protections. The rapid shift was partly driven by public demand for safer, more transparent online options and the economic potential of regulated markets.

Current Regulatory Landscape & Its Impacts

Province Regulatory Approach Key Regulations Market Impact
Ontario Fully regulated online market (since 2022) Mandatory licensing, consumer safeguards, responsible gambling protocols Rapid growth; many operators partnering with the Ontario Lottery and Gaming Corporation (OLG) to gain access
Quebec Licensed online gambling operated by Loto-Québec Strict licensing, online casino and sports betting regulated Stable but controlled growth; emphasis on state-operated platforms
Other provinces Mixed regulation or unregulated Varies from liberal licensing to outright bans Fragmented market, with unlicensed operators still active

As the table illustrates, Canada’s approach varies significantly across provinces, shaping the landscape for both operators and players. The move towards comprehensive regulation aims to build trust and ensure consumer protection, particularly given the proliferation of offshore platforms offering services without oversight.

Technological Innovations and Player Experience

Modern online casinos are embracing innovations such as live dealer games, blockchain-based transactions, and VR environments that simulate the physical casino atmosphere. These advancements have raised the baseline for entertainment, security, and fairness.

For example, live dealer platforms, which enable real-time interaction with human dealers via high-definition streaming, have become a standard feature in legal Canadian markets, providing transparency and a social dimension that many players value. Blockchain integrations facilitate faster, more secure transactions, fostering more trust, which is crucial in a landscape where illicit operators pose risks.

Trust and Credibility: The Role of Regulation and Responsible Gambling

Trust is paramount in online gambling. According to recent industry data, approximately 65% of Canadian players prefer regulated platforms because they guarantee safety, fair play, and data security. Regulatory bodies enforce strict standards, requiring operators to implement robust identity verification and responsible gambling features such as self-exclusion tools, deposit limits, and player education programs.
